Étape 6: Electronics
Matériaux & dossiers :
Aigle fabduino fichiers
Composants & PCB board stock
Bouclier WiFi
Comme mentionné précédemment, mon objectif initial était pour envoyer les coordonnées GPS de mon téléphone à un serveur Web, retirez ces données avec un microcontrôleur WiFi activé et qui permettent de contrôler le servo.
Téléphone--> serveur Web--> WiFi activé microcontrôleur--> déplacer ce servo !
L’horloge actuelle est juste commandé depuis mon ordinateur. Toutefois, je suis notamment des instructions pour l’électronique pour toute personne qui se sent comme essayer leur main à faire leur propre PCB. Si vous êtes assez nouveau à l’électronique je voudrais sauter cette section car il est rempli avec beaucoup de jargon comme « MOSI », « SCK » et « Riddikulus ».
Parce que toutes les bibliothèques pour le module WiFi, que j’ai eu sont faites pour un Arduino, il fait le plus de sens pour utiliser un Arduino comme mon microcontrôleur. Entrez dans le Fabduino ! Le Fabduino est essentiellement un Arduino DIY, et c’est génial. Avec le Fabduino, vous pouvez programmer le bouclier WiFi comme si il est attaché à un Arduino. Il y a déjà une grande documentation en ligne, y compris le
et du Fabkit .
Pour la conception de mon propre Conseil, j’ai fait quelques modifications sur les commissions existantes :
- Enlever des broches je n’aurais pas besoin pour le servo ou bouclier WiFi. (J’ai quitté un jeu supplémentaire de broches pour un second servo, dans le cas où je décide d’ajouter une autre aiguille par la suite)
- Ajout d’un régulateur de tension et une prise pour alimentation externe
- Ajout de résistances aux broches MOSI/MISO/SCK qui seront utilisés par le programmeur de l’ISP et le bouclier WiFi et une traction vers le haut de résistance sur la broche de CS
- À l’aide d’un ATMega328p sur ma planche plutôt que sur les 168, puisque c’était dans l’inventaire j’ai eu accès à.
- À l’aide de résonateur 20 MHz, au lieu de résonateur de 16 MHz puisque c’est ce que j’avais sous la main (j’ai fait une deuxième chambre plus tard en qui je crois que j’ai utilisé le 16 MHz)
Si vous souhaitez modifier le Fabduino plus loin, jetez un oeil à la documentation sur le bouclier WiFi.
Ou, si vous préférez aller dans la voie magique, essayez d’utiliser un charme « Point Me » à la place.